Most of the materials used for upholstery are sold without a warranty. Therefore, you need to be sure of what you select before you make any payments. You could minimize your chances of going at a loss, by visiting only reputable stores. The people running these places will not risk ruining their reputation by selling low-quality merchandise.

When dealing with fabric before you purchase a couple meters, you should ask for a sample piece. This will be a small rectangular piece which you can take home. While this might seem like it is making the process longer running comparisons against the other furniture in the room will ensure that you choose the right color and pattern. Additionally, you will know how the material reacts to wear and tear and exposure to sunlight.
